Regardless of all the symbolism and cute execution of the beauty and beast concept, I found today's episode lacking.It seemed to miss the intensity that I was expecting. I also have lowered my expectations for future episodes and partly the spoilers are to blame for it.
If I were to look at last 3 episodes, we have had an indirect confession from both Arnav and Khushi and they have been communicated to each other in right spirit. Not only that a lot of hints have been given by Arnav and Khushi regarding MU and the hurt they feel. This is enough for both of them to stat digging deeper but it does not seem we are going to end up in that route. Instead we will continue to meander here and there along the way and get there in couple of weeks when the impact will be completely lost.
What I liked today-
1) Instead of barging in and throwing a fit, Arnav decided to investigate Khushi's latest project. I like to think his character is growing and he has learnt something from recent fiasco.
2) Khushi did not forget and is still angry with Arnav.
3) Arnav realizes that he overreacted and is suitably guilty even if he tries to hide it behind his grumpiness.
4) We got an inkling of Arnav's dry humour when he was threatening to eat Nikhil.
5)Anjali gets the last note in which Khushi's heartbreak is evident. I am keeping my fingers crossed that this leads to something understated and good. She is the only one who knows them both inside out and how much they care for each other.
What I did not get-
1) Arnav had told Khushi she is not to leave Raizada house without his permission. She vanishes for two day, the bed is not slept in and Arnav does not react on finding her. Where is joy and relief at finding her? Where are the questions?
2) Nani is supporting Khushi's business, Does it not occur to her that a newlywed wife who supposedly married in love is filling every living hour with some task...when is she going to spend some time with her husband ? She also seems to ignore huge communication gap between the couple. She seems to support Khushi's ventures like dabba service and tutions but not once has suggested that she help Arnav in his business or take interest in some non profit organization which is how most families with Raizada status would approach Khushi's quest for independence and identity. Same goes for Guptas, they have not once questioned Khushi why she intends to be so busy while most newlyweds wish to spend time together.
3)As Khushi narrates the tale, she stumbles on the the duality of Arnav's behaviour. For the first time she has said it out loud and that led to realization of what she feels for him and her confusion. One would expect a reaction akin to light bulb. One would expect a renewed sense of purpose to explore the mystery. She has connected some dots, Arnav is not all bad...he did care for her at times, he did confess as Ranjha despite his denial and yet something seems to bring him to precipice of barely controlled fury later that evening. If she were to analyze all such scenarios she would find a common thread...Shyam. But what does she do, she sighs sadly and moves on much to my disappointment.
4)Arnav is hearing the narrative, he should have reacted more strongly to being both the prince and the beast in her tale. He is more experienced and hence would understand that Khushi feels something for him unlike what he thought. I would not expect him to shed tear as he did on Holi but some some expression of thoughfulness with tempered hope would not be remiss... instead we see a fleeting look of being stunned and then he ignores the sign and moves on to postal services
5)Lastly but not the least, I do not understand Payal. For two sisters that were practically joined at the hip for most of thier life, Payal seemed to have adopted an almost careless and ignorant attitude towards Khushi's life and projects.
